I work with a lady that wanted me to make her a quilt. Her church charges $55 to make a quilt from donated fabric so she wanted me to make a quilt for the same amount without donated fabric. I did the math out loud for her and said, "Quilting is an expensive hobby. I cannot make a quilt for $55. The materials for your church are DONATED. If you want to donate the fabric, I will certainly make it for $55" She walked away in disgust.
